The answer is Irish. Colm Tóibín is an Irish novelist, short-story writer, essayist, playwright, and poet. Born in Enniscorthy, County Wexford, Ireland, he has been associated with the New Yorker magazine since 1992. His work has been translated into more than 30 languages and has received numerous awards and accolades, including the Costa Book Award, the Impac Dublin Literary Award, and the PEN/Malamud Award.
